Practical anode-free sodium batteries (AFSBs) require high-temperature adaptability, e.g., stable operation at 45°C. However, current AFSBs are usually confined to room/low temperatures, and pouch cell-level AFSBs capable of stable cycling >25°C have rarely been reported. Here we report high-temperature AFSBs via spatially strengthened ion-dipole electrolyte chemistry. Specifically, a novel solvent, namely, ethyl tetrahydrofurfuryl ether (ETFE) is designed. The reversely anchored rigid cyclic head endows ETFE molecule with weakened steric hindrance effect and stronger cyclic ethereal O─Na+ interaction accordingly, hence spatially strengthening overall ion-dipole interaction. Consequently, less vulnerable free solvents, ameliorated electrolyte decomposition, and formation of stable electrode/electrolyte interphases enable highly reversible Na plating/stripping behaviors at elevated temperatures. Further, an ampere hour (Ah)-level pouch cell capable of 200 cycles at 45°C with a capacity retention of 89.1% is realized even after initial 300-cycle ageing at 25°C, featuring the first long-term HT evaluation toward pouch cell-level AFSBs. This work should expedite the practicability of AFSBs.
